For the 2024 school year, there are 11 private preschools offering winter track as an interscholastic sport serving 5,071 students in Florida.
The top ranked offering winter track sport private preschools in Florida include St. Theresa School, Conchita Espinosa Academy and St. Barnabas Episcopal School.
The average acceptance rate is 81%, which is lower than the Florida private preschool average acceptance rate of 85%.
91% of private preschools offering winter track sport in Florida are religiously affiliated (most commonly Catholic and Lutheran Church Missouri Synod).
